Warning Signs You Need Pool Leak Water Removal
Ignoring pool leaks can lead to more costly repairs down the line. Here are some common warning signs that show you need pool leak water removal: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ell around your pool, it may be a sign of a leak. Don’t ignore it, address the issue before it gets worse.
Visible Water Stains
If you notice water stains or discoloration on your pool deck or surrounding surfaces, it’s likely a sign of a leak. Our team can help you identify and repair the issue before it causes further damage.
Increased Water Bill
A sudden spike in your water bill may show a leak in your pool. This is often a sign of a more significant issue that needs prompt attention.
Unusual Pool Behavior
If your pool is behaving erratically, draining too quickly, not filling up properly, or experiencing other unusual issues, it may be a sign of a leak. Our team can help you identify and repair the issue.
